Enhanced User Experience through Personalization
Predictive analytics enables a highly personalized experience in Smash or Pass games. By analyzing previous choices and interactions, the AI can predict which types of images or characters a user is likely to find appealing. For instance, if a user consistently chooses certain types of characters, the AI will begin to present more of those types, thereby increasing user engagement and satisfaction.

Improved Accuracy of Matchmaking
In Smash or Pass games that involve social elements, predictive analytics is used to enhance the matchmaking process among users. The AI assesses compatibility based on users’ choices and can predict potential matches with higher accuracy. This is particularly valuable in versions of the game designed for dating or social networking.
